Malta summit urges EU to stop migration at source
Oct 01, 2023
Mdina[Malta], October 1: The leaders of nine Mediterranean and southern European countries called Friday for a "significant increase" in the EU's efforts to tackle the thorny issue of migration at its roots, in origin and transit countries. Italian far-right Prime Minister Giorgia Meloni said that front-line countries were struggling to deal with arrivals now, but without "structural" solutions from the bloc, "everyone will be overwhelmed". A sharp rise in migrants landing on the tiny Italian island of Lampedusa earlier this month has reignited tensions within the bloc and provided impetus to work for a fresh common strategy.
